Contractor Accommodation Near Local Work Sites in Ipswich
—
When a contractor arrives in Ipswich for a long-running project, the priorities are clear: convenient access to sites, reliable WiFi for planning and reporting, and a comfortable base that supports extended stays without breaking the budget. Ipswich offers a practical solution through high-quality contractor accommodation that sits near local work sites while keeping residents connected to the town centre, major transport routes, and the region’s logistics hubs.
Think of Ipswich as a hub for industrial and commercial activity in Suffolk. From the moment you step off Ipswich station or hop in on the A14, you’re within easy reach of both urban amenities and the outlying industrial estates that power projects at Felixstowe Port and surrounding logistics areas. For contractors, this proximity translates into less time commuting and more time on site, which is a straightforward win for productivity and morale.

The economics of contractor accommodation in Ipswich are built around long-stay savings. Hotels can quickly escalate costs when you factor in daily rates, parking surcharges, and incidental fees. A serviced or fully furnished apartment, with a kitchen and laundry facilities, offers tangible cost savings over hotels for extended deployments. The ability to cook meals, handle laundering in-house, and maintain a predictable weekly budget reduces daily overhead and helps contract managers forecast expenses with greater accuracy.
